Q:

What part of the atom has a positive charge?

A) Neutron B) Proton
C) Electron D) All the above
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: B) Proton

Explanation:

Protons carry a positive electrical charge, electrons carry a negative electrical charge and neutrons carry no electrical charge at all. The protons and neutrons cluster together in the central part of the atom, called the nucleus, and the electrons 'orbit' the nucleus.

Q:

When an already listed organisation makes fresh issue of securities to the public, it is known as ________.

A) IPO B) Preferential Issue
C) Rights Issue D) FPO
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: D) FPO

Explanation:

FPO (Follow on Public Offer) is a process by which a company, which is already listed on an exchange, issues new shares to the investors or the existing shareholders, usually the promoters. FPO is used by companies to diversify their equity base. A follow-on public offer (FPO) is also called Further Public Offer.

Q:

6 choose 3 =

A) 20 B) 30
C) 18 D) 24
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: A) 20

Explanation:

6 choose 3 means number of possible unordered combinations when 3 items are selected from 6 available items i.e, nothing but 6C3.

Now 6C3 = 6 x 5 x 4/3 x 2 x 1 = 120/6 = 20.

Q:

Identify the sentence in which an adverb clause is used.

A) Many of the team members were inexperienced players who were playing in their first championship game. B) Although rain was drenching the players the players still finished the game.
C) The game was played under the bright lights so that the players could see well enough to hit the ball. D) All of the above
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: B) Although rain was drenching the players the players still finished the game.

Explanation:

'Although rain was drenching the players the players still finished the game' is the correct sentence in which an adverb clause is underlined. This adverb clause starts with a subordinating conjunction 'although' and contains a subject 'rain' and the verb is 'was drenching'. The adverb clause changes the verb 'finished' in the main clause.
